Michel Pereyre is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Inorganic Chemistry and Ocean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Michel Pereyre has authored 102 papers receiving a total of 1.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 92 papers in Organic Chemistry, 20 papers in Inorganic Chemistry and 14 papers in Ocean Engineering. Recurrent topics in Michel Pereyre’s work include Organometallic Compounds Synthesis and Characterization (40 papers),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(20 papers) and Radical Photochemical Reactions (14 papers). Michel Pereyre is often cited by papers focused on Organometallic Compounds Synthesis and Characterization (40 papers),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(20 papers) and Radical Photochemical Reactions (14 papers). Michel Pereyre collaborates with scholars based in France, United States and Italy. Michel Pereyre's co-authors include Jean‐Paul Quintard, Gilles Dumartin, Alain Rahm, B. Jousseaume, Éric Fouquet, Bernard Delmond, Alain L. Rodriguez, Jean‐Baptiste Verlhac, Nicolas Noiret and Jacques Valade and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, The Journal of Organic Chemistry and Tetrahedron.
